F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

Correctmax is a powdered food supplement with hydrolyzed collagen peptides, vitamins and minerals.
Each sachet contains 35 kcal.
We recommend using 2 sachets a day for adults, but stress the importance of consulting a health professional for an individualized prescription according to each individual's nutritional needs.
Studies and nutritional societies show that a balanced diet and some specific nutrients can help the wound healing process. These include L-arginine, vitamins A, C, E, selenium and zinc. Each has a role to play during wound recovery.
In cases of acute wounds such as burns, cuts, pressure injuries or trauma. Chronic wounds such as diabetic foot, venous insufficiency and/or infected wounds. Post-operative care for patients undergoing minor or major surgery.
It provides peptides such as proline-hydroxyproline that signal fibroblasts to heal. They are crucial in the granulation and remodeling phases, improving tensile strength and healing agility.
